Description
As we move into the next phase in the grouping of University Hospitals of Northamptonshire (UHN) and University Hospitals of Leicestershire (UHL) there is a requirement for a Group Head of Digital Programme Management Office.

The role of the Group Head of Digital Programme Management Office will be responsible for the development, implementation and management of a comprehensive Digital Transformation Portfolio across University Hospitals of Leicester NHS Trust and University Hospitals of Northamptonshire NHS Group.

The post holder is responsible for introducing and embedding an industry recognised project, programme methodology and culture across the group. The establishment of a Digital PMO function across the Group, and professional leadership of the departments project and programme management function.

The Group Head of Digital Programme Management Office is a key driver of strategic excellence for the Digital function and will make decisions regarding budget, resources and project/programme scopes. A key output of the role will be to ensure the “show back” cost of Digital projects and programmes is understood and coordinated to the wider organisation. These will inform decision making in respect to portfolio priorities, as well as analysis of the total cost of ownership for the proposed solutions.

The post holder will draw upon a range of standardised methodologies to devise and maintain the Portfolio Plan with professional rigour, including agile and more traditional P3O, PRINCE2 and Managing Successful Programmes (MSP).

The Group Head of Digital Programme Management Office will be responsible for coordinating with enterprise architects to ensure that the contract roadmap is understood, so that the planning and appropriate business case development takes place well in advance of the renewal and expiry dates.
